Much of the world’s honey now contains bee-harming pesticides
Global survey finds neonicotinoids in three-fourths of samples
![honeybees](https://i0.wp.com/www.sciencenews.org/wp-content/uploads/2017/10/100417_LH_neonicotinoid_main.jpg?fit=860%2C460&ssl=1)
NOT SO SWEET A global survey of honey found neonicotinoid pesticides in most of the samples. That suggests honeybees are bringing the chemicals back to their hives.
